PROBLEM TO BE SOLVED: To provide an unmanned transportation vehicle system in which it is not required to carry out charging while leaving transportation work in a circulation passage, or to replace power storage means.SOLUTION: An unmanned transportation vehicle system S1 includes a preset circulation passage R, an unmanned transportation vehicle V travelling automatically therealong, and stopping at multiple stop positions H, and power transmission devices A placed at respective stop positions H. The unmanned transportation vehicle V includes a power reception device B for receiving power, in non-contact, from the power transmission device A during stoppage and outputting while rectifying, a capacitor 6 for accumulating power outputted therefrom, and a motor 8 being driven with power from the capacitor 6. By power transmission at the stop positions H, the capacitor 6 is charged from a first voltage Vc1 to a second voltage Vc2, and the distance Dx between the stop positions H is set to satisfy a relation Dx≤X×α×Cc×(Vc2-Vc1)/(2×Id×Vd), where capacitance of the capacitor 6 is Cc, a predetermined factor is α, travel speed of the unmanned transportation vehicle V is X, driving voltage of the motor 8 is Vd, and the driving current is Id.SELECTED DRAWING: Figure 1
